Answers: What you are talking in the order of is called aspiration pneumonia. In the years that I have worked in respiratory, I don't bring to mind having a healthy patient next to aspiration pneumonia. Those who are most likely to have aspiration pneumonia are those who lose consciousness, those who have be intubated and vomitted during the process, people with dysphagia "difficulty swallowing", and those that are comatose. I am sure that there are more factor out there that cause aspiration pneumonia than what I have down. The likely hood that your mom actually has chips within her lungs is very small. She probably coughed it up if it did go in the airway. We own a gag reflex in our airway that helps to prevent the wrong things from going down there. Keep an eye on her and if she starts to run a hallucination, then contact the Dr. She will probably suffer from a sore throat for a few days if it did go down the wrong pipe.
